The International Carnivorous Plant Society (ICPS) is an organization of horticulturists, conservationists, scientists, and educators all interested in sharing knowledge and news of carnivorous plants. Since its founding in 1972, the Society has been an integral part of the carnivorous plant world.
The ICPS is probably best known for its color publication, Carnivorous
Plant Newsletter. But there are many more reasons that membership
in the Society is so exciting. Members have access to the ICPS seed
bank and can attend the international meetings. Many carnivorous
plant nurseries provide discounts to ICPS members.
Today the ICPS is expanding. It is growing in membership and evolving
in perspective. While the Society was once just a club of plant
growers, it has evolved into a truly international society with
a professional quality journal, an increasing voice in the world
of conservation, and a network of horticulturists larger than ever
before. The Society is a registered US IRS 501(c)(3) nonprofit corporation and is the International Registration Authority
(IRA) for carnivorous plant cultivars.
